Why Basmati is Popular in UAE Markets?

The naturally aromatic flavor and long slender grains, soft texture and nice appearance when cooked are all important qualities of Indian basmati. These are the attributes for which it is used in biryani, pulao, mandi, catering and on a regular basis.

Consistency is especially crucial for UAE importers as customers tend to have high expectations for the same performance and appearance with each purchase. Correctly processed and graded basmati can enable businesses to ensure the consistent product quality from batch to batch.

What Makes Quality So Important for UAE Buyers?

The good quality of rice starts long before it reaches the export market. The selection of paddy, the milling process, sorting, grading, packaging and the storage can all impact on the final product.

Some key quality factors are:

Grain length and appearance: Uniform, slender grains create the presentation attractive.

Aroma and cooking qualities: True basmati should have unique aroma and the texture.

Moisture and cleanliness: Controlled moisture and the effective cleaning contribute to good storage and handling.

Batch consistency: Uniform grain quality from batches assists businesses in maintaining product quality.

These factors prove to be more useful for the rice distributors and the food-service industry who buy rice in bulk.
